PH of salivary secretion
Specify the approximate pH of salivary secretion? Whether it is an acid or basic fluid? List the main functions of the saliva?
Expert
PH of the saliva is about 6.8. Thus, it is slightly acidic pH. Saliva secretes food bolus and starts enzymatic extracellular digestion of the food. It does the work of buffer for mouth pH and it performs the chief role of having IgA antibodies which protect the organism from pathogens, also present in the tears, colostrums, and mother’s milk and in mucosa of the intestine and airways.
